Tammy is an associate, and earlier this month, she brought three assistants along for an exciting fundraising experience!
First, meet Max! Max was born with Right Hypoplastic Heart Syndrome; meaning, he has only half a heart. In his short life he has already fought through three open heart surgeries. Next up, Corbin! Corbin was born with a severe hernia and underdeveloped lungs, leaving him with a 10% chance at survival. Despite their different challenges, Max, Corbin and his little brother Sam, still came out to help Tammy fundraise at Walmart. The team served cotton candy and hot dogs to customers all day. Their efforts were able to raise $355.97!

We are so proud of the work Tammy, Max, Corbin, Sam, and others like them are doing every day. Tammy told us, “It is an amazing feeling when businesses and individuals that have donated to CMN get to actually interact with the children they have helped!”
